Introduction to Manual Milk Frother Wands

Manual milk frother wands are handheld devices designed to froth milk by introducing air into it, thus creating a creamy foam. These wands are typically made of stainless steel or plastic and consist of a handle and a whisking head. The simplicity of their design belies the complexity of the techniques involved in using them effectively. With practice, however, users can achieve a variety of textures, from silky microfoam for lattes to thicker, more velvety foam for cappuccinos.

Choosing the Right Milk

Before diving into the technique of using a manual milk frother wand, it’s essential to consider the type of milk being used. The fat content of the milk can significantly affect the frothing process. Whole milk, with its higher fat content, tends to produce a richer, more luxurious foam, while skim milk and non-dairy alternatives may require adjustments in temperature and frothing technique to achieve the desired consistency. Experimenting with different types of milk can help users find their preferred flavor and texture.

Preparing the Milk

To froth milk effectively, it’s crucial to start with cold milk. Cold milk froths better than warmed milk because the cold temperature helps to strengthen the milk proteins, which are essential for creating a stable foam. If the milk is not cold enough, the froth may not hold its shape well. Refrigerating the milk before use is a good practice. Additionally, using fresh milk is vital, as older milk may not froth as well due to the breakdown of its proteins over time.

The Frothing Process

The actual process of frothing milk with a manual wand involves several key steps, each critical to achieving the perfect foam.

Heating the Milk (Optional)

While cold milk is best for frothing, some users prefer their milk heated before or after frothing for a warmer beverage. If heating is desired, it’s best to do so gently to avoid scalding the milk, which can destroy its ability to froth. Microwaving in short intervals and checking the temperature is a safe method, as is using a thermometer to ensure the milk does not exceed 140°F to 150°F, the ideal temperature range for frothing.

Frothing the Milk

  1. Submerge the whisking head of the frother into the milk, ensuring it’s fully immersed to prevent introducing too much air prematurely.
  2. Hold the frother at an angle to allow for smooth movement and to prevent the milk from splashing out.
  3. Begin whisking in a smooth, steady motion, moving the frother up and down. The speed and motion will depend on the desired froth consistency.
  4. As froth begins to form, introduce more air by slightly tilting the frother or moving it closer to the surface. This step requires finesse, as too much air can result in a froth that’s too stiff or separates.
  5. Continue frothing until the desired consistency is achieved. This can range from a few seconds for a light foam to several minutes for a thicker, more velvety foam.

Tips for Achieving the Perfect Froth

  • Pitcher size matters: Using a pitcher that’s too large can make it difficult to froth the milk effectively, as the wand may not be able to introduce air evenly throughout the milk.
  • Cleanliness is key: Ensure the frother and pitcher are clean and free of any residual milk or soap, as these can affect the frothing process.
  • Practice makes perfect: Mastering the technique of manual milk frothing takes time and practice. Be patient and experiment with different techniques and types of milk.

Maintenance and Care

To ensure the longevity and effectiveness of a manual milk frother wand, regular maintenance is essential.

Cleaning the Frother

After each use, the frother should be thoroughly cleaned with warm water to remove any milk residue. Soaking the frother in warm soapy water can help loosen dried milk, and a soft brush can be used to gently scrub away any stubborn particles. Rinsing the frother thoroughly and drying it with a clean towel will prevent water spots and bacterial growth.

Storage

When not in use, the frother should be stored in a dry place. Avoid storing the frother in a humid environment or near direct sunlight, as this can lead to corrosion or damage to the materials.
